The ±¬×ß³Ô¹Ï College women's basketball team defeated Fulton Montgomery CC 50-45 in the championship game of the 2010 ASC Tournament. The Lady Pioneers head into the the Thanksgiving break with a 7-3 mark.
Tournament MVP Amie Brooks (Pavilion) led the Lady Pioneers with 16 points while Khaylah Moss (Chenango Valley) had a double-double with 10 points and 13 rebounds. Camille Romero (Queens Valley/Mary Louis) came off the bench and chipped in six while Nuri Bey (Bronx/Evander Childs) finished with 10 boards.
Rene Blake led FMCC with 12 points, 14 rebounds, and seven assists. Joycelyn Cummings and Carina Moore both finished with nine each.
±¬×ß³Ô¹Ï led 24-17 at half but FMCC rallied and took the lead before the Lady Pioneers went on a run in the last ten minutes to secure the win.
Brooks was joined on the all-tournament team by Moss, FMCC's Blake and Jasmine Miller, Jefferson CC's Emily Males, and Hagerstown's Alessandra Flores. Hagerstown (MD) defeated Jefferson CC 69-28 in the consolation game.
